About Amy Grossman, Lnha

Amy Grossman, LNHA, serves as the Executive Director at Brightview Senior Living in Great Falls, VA, where she has worked since 2017. With over two decades of experience in senior living, she has held various leadership roles at Erickson Living and has a strong background in health policy and business administration.

Current Role at Brightview Senior Living

Amy Grossman serves as the Executive Director at Brightview Senior Living in Great Falls, VA. She has held this position since 2017, bringing over six years of leadership experience to the role. In her capacity, she oversees operations, ensuring high standards of care and service within the senior living community.

Previous Experience at Erickson Living

Prior to her current role, Amy Grossman held various positions at Erickson Living from 1999 to 2017. She started as an Assistant Executive Director at Brooksby Village in Peabody, MA, and later served as Administrator/Director of Continuing Care at Ashby Ponds in Ashburn, VA. Additionally, she worked as an Assistant Administrator and Associate Executive Director at Greenspring Village and Ashby Ponds, respectively.

Educational Background

Amy Grossman earned her Bachelor of Science degree in Health Policy Administration from Penn State University, studying from 1993 to 1996. She later pursued a Master of Business Administration at Bentley College, completing her studies from 2000 to 2003. Her educational background supports her extensive experience in senior living management.
